How it all began
With an ex-military founder, we started out as a lifeline for people leaving the armed forces. People with a get-it-done mindset and problem-solving skills, who were cast adrift in a job market that didn’t see their value.
We helped them to harness their leadership traits… to formalise the skills they had, and tap their hidden talents… and get qualified, ready for a fresh start or promotion.
Soon, other people took notice. People from other walks of life, ready for the next step.
Then businesses, charities, public bodies – asking us to give their teams the same leadership skills. (Then teaching skills. Then any skill that would solve a problem!)
Before long, we were the go-to team for any training package. Trusted by corporate giants, educators, local authorities… even the MOD.
Today, we’re true to our roots, helping ex-service people – and many others – to unlock their potential. While working with private clients who see a chance to work smarter… and protect their future… by investing in their people.

Minerva Elite Performance Proudly Partners with The ELY Memorial Fund
We are proud to sponsor The ELY Memorial Fund: a Herefordshire-based charity supporting families through the aftermath of losing a young person aged 17–25 in a road traffic collision.
As an organisation that helps people to rebuild through lifelong learning, we share the values of this hard-working charity. Their full range of services – road safety education, financial assistance and compassionate support – resonates deeply with our values, and this makes them an ideal choice as our charitable partner.
“We’re honoured to support such a meaningful cause,” says Craig Smith, Head of Education & Quality Assurance at MEP. “The ELY Memorial Fund works tirelessly to uplift families during their darkest times, and we look forward to building a strong and impactful partnership.”
Through this collaboration, MEP will be actively involved in awareness campaigns, fundraising efforts and community-focused initiatives, working side by side to create lasting change.
